[24/26] Input: synaptics-rmi4: use device managed memory for the data packet buffer

The data packet should use device managed memory since the buffer is
retained until the device goes away.

diff --git a/drivers/input/rmi4/rmi_f11.c b/drivers/input/rmi4/rmi_f11.c
index ee4b155..10a0c11 100644
--- a/drivers/input/rmi4/rmi_f11.c
+++ b/drivers/input/rmi4/rmi_f11.c
@@ -683,7 +683,8 @@  static int f11_2d_construct_data(struct f11_data *f11)
 		sensor->pkt_size +=
 			DIV_ROUND_UP(query->nr_touch_shapes + 1, 8);
 
-	sensor->data_pkt = kzalloc(sensor->pkt_size, GFP_KERNEL);
+	sensor->data_pkt = devm_kzalloc(&sensor->fn->dev, sensor->pkt_size,
+					GFP_KERNEL);
 	if (!sensor->data_pkt)
 		return -ENOMEM;
